    Discover more about Piazza Monteoliveto

    Piazza Monteoliveto is a hidden gem nestled in the heart of Naples, offering visitors a delightful escape into the vibrant culture of this historic city. This picturesque square is flanked by remarkable architecture, including the ornate Church of Monteoliveto, which showcases stunning Baroque design elements that are sure to captivate art and history enthusiasts alike. Strolling through the square, tourists can soak in the lively atmosphere, where local vendors often set up shop, offering an array of traditional Neapolitan delicacies and artisanal crafts. The charm of Piazza Monteoliveto extends beyond its visual appeal; it serves as a vibrant gathering place for locals and visitors, making it an ideal spot to pause and enjoy a coffee or a gelato while people-watching. The square is often alive with the sounds of street musicians and performers, adding to the lively ambiance that characterizes Naples. Nearby, you can explore charming alleyways that lead to other notable attractions, allowing you to delve deeper into the rich tapestry of Neapolitan life. Whether you're seeking a quiet moment of reflection in this beautiful square or looking to engage with the bustling local scene, Piazza Monteoliveto promises an authentic taste of Naples that will resonate long after your visit. The blend of historical significance, architectural beauty, and lively community spirit makes this square a must-visit destination for any traveler exploring Naples.
